Last night I was looking for some new music and put out an open call on Twitter. This was one of the standout submissions. Capital Ode (pronounced: Kap- Tal Oh-Dee) is an artist from Brooklyn and this is his first single. He’s got a confident, unrushed flow that flirts with a 3 Stacks vibe from time to time. So many young rappers try to fake their way through a verse, putting on their best “rapper voice” and mimicking flows that have been spit to death. Something about Capital Ode seems completely natural, and I fuck with it. Check out “Success Or Death” below.
